Urban Justice (A Chicago Vigilantes Novel Book 2) by India Kells – Review by Erica Fish

Urban Justice (A Chicago Vigilantes Novel #2)Urban Justice by India Kells
My rating: 4 of 5 stars

This is the second book in the two-book series. I have enjoyed both books, but I think that I like the second book slightly more. India Kells has been my go-to author when I am looking for a juicy book to read. The action and adventures pulled me in from the beginning. I kept turning the pages and I had to read this in one sitting. The book is about a group of crimefighters that are a Vigilante group. The leader is a woman, Sloane who happens to be a police officer who works with this group. They are out to get the Phantom who is terrorizing Chicago. There may be a love relationship steaming between Sloane and one of the vigilante members. Can Sloane and the Vigilante stop the Phantom? Will they be the group that keeps Chicago safe? I highly recommend reading this book to find out the answers to these questions and much more.
